#0ef538 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#0ef538 is composed of 5.5% red, 96.1%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 94.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 77.1% yellow and 3.9% black. It has a hue angle of 130.9 degrees, a saturation of 92% and a lightness of 50.8%. #0ef538 color hex could be obtained by blending #1cff70 with #00eb00. Closest websafe color is: #00ff33.

Shades and Tints of #0ef538

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000401 is the darkest color, while #f0fef3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#0ef538

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#788b7c is the less saturated color, while #04ff32 is the most saturated one.
